David Beckham and Victoria Beckham Wedding: The marriage of David and Victoria Beckham took place on July 4, 1999, at Luttrellstown Castle, near Dublin, Ireland. Victoria Beckham wore a champagne colored satin dress designed by Vera Wang. Though the reception was attended by hundreds of people, the wedding ceremony itself was held in a small, private room of the castle and witnessed only by family and close friends. The wedding guests drank rose champagne by Laurent Perrier and enjoyed an elaborate spread of food. Hence, the reception required over 400 attendants. One of the popular dishes was the sticky toffee pudding, Beckham's favorite. The guests at the wedding were asked to dress in either black or white, lending an elegant air to a very graceful and refined ceremony. To celebrate the wedding, the couple released doves, and later lit the sky with a fireworks show. According to New Zealand's Sunday Times, the couple had a short honeymoon in a villa in the south of France, with just the two of them and their infant son, Brooklyn.
Victoria Beckham: Victoria Adams was born on April 17, 1974, in Hertfordshire, England. She has a brother, Christian, and sister, Louise, and her parents, Jackie and Tony, ran a successful electrical wholesale business and were well off by most standards. Victoria Beckham likes spending quality time with family and friends, or singing for her personal album. She enjoys expensive clothes and makeup and is happiest when buying from Gucci or Harvey Nichols. Recently, she spent over 43,000 pounds on a Christmas shopping spree in London, buying luxury gifts for herself and her husband.
